Vivadent introduces Astralis 7, a new premier polymerization light. It features three different programs, which adjust the light intensity to the clinical situation at hand.

Astralis 7 is not affected by voltage fluctuations and is always ready to use - electronic controls compensate for voltage fluctuations and ensure consistent performance.
